Default Weird start/ coolant ??

1. My 95 Lt1 vette will make a "click" noise and not start up. sometimes if i turn on the Acc. first (and let the gauge popup and let the DIC lights disappear) then start it, it will crank up. I wanted to know if this is supposed to be the process of starting the car or if it needs a new starter (was told) or something.

and 2. I read on another post that the avg. coolant temp should be around 220-230 warm. is this true? because last week it was around 85 degrees outside, and my vette stayed around 215-230 and the coolant needle was very close to the hashmark (also should is that normal?)

You might want to check connections going to the starter before replacing it.

Have you ever cleaned out the rad? See if there is blockage at the rad and in front of the ac condenser. If there is it will limit air flow and inhibit cooling.

Sounds like you could have a starter going. I would check battery cable connections first make sure they are clean and tight. Is it a louder click (thunk) like the starter solenoid kicking in?

Is that running down the road or in town?

If that is running down the road, start looking at cleaning the junk out of the radiator/condenser assy.

My 93 with clean rad/condenser, new coolant mixed with distilled water, stock Stant 180 t-stat running down the road today (about 70 outside or so) I run about 190-195. In town it does creep up until primary fan kicks in at 228.
